An International, Bilingual Flair

A Glendon education is set in a vibrantly international and bilingual environment. Students, professors and staff hail from more than 100 countries around the world and value the opportunity to study, live and work in English and French – and other languages. As Southern Ontario’s Centre of Excellence for Bilingual and French‑Language Postsecondary Education, Glendon is committed to equipping all students with skills in French (or English for Francophones) both in and outside of the classroom. Whether you are a beginner or more advanced, all students graduate with language certification that can prove a key advantage in the workforce, where more jobs and more money often come to those who can work in both languages.

Glendon – A Natural Jewel

Glendon's peaceful and inspiring campus is set on 85 lush acres of parkland and gardens in the heart of Toronto's mid-town. With a historic Manor at its centre, a close-knit, diverse community of professors, staff and students call it home. 

A Sense of Community

Glendon is great for students interested in a personalized university experience. With a student population of just under 3,000 and an average class size of 28, you will get to know your professors and fellow students well. You will find that in the classroom and across campus, professors and staff are here to support your success. Our small campus gives you opportunities to shine, to connect with students from across the country and around the world, and to get involved in campus life.
